Default air-conditioning compressor with a eldebrock 3 deuce

I am looking to add a air conditioning system to my 41 ford pickup with a 59AB block. Anyone used brackets and pulleys that worked well? Or is this something I am going to need to fabricate? my engine and radiator combination does a good job of running cool so I am not worried about that and I can add a electric fan if needed to replace the crankshaft fan blade which I assume will be necessary. Looking for ideas.

I built an A/C system for my 52 F3. I like my stock generator mount and don't like the mounts that use the GM alternator with the compressor next to it. Ended up building a compressor mount that fit on the driver side cylinder head. Used the Sanden compressor made for wide belt Flathead Fords.
